Silence
JJ Heller's song "Silence" is a gentle, comforting ballad about sitting with someone in their pain and uncertainty. The lyrics acknowledge the weariness of anxious thoughts and the feeling of being trapped in fear, but offer a quiet presence as a source of solace. The song speaks to the idea that some dreams must die before they can be reborn, hinting at resurrection and hope. It reassures listeners that even when the world is overwhelming, they are not alone. The overall tone is tender and pastoral, emphasizing God's nearness in silence and suffering.
